According to the front desk at BWV, all resorts now charge your room charges to your credit card on file every 2 or 3 days even if you haven't hit the $1500 limit. This makes it difficult to pay your room tab with a rewards or gift card. They will reverse the credit card charge but state that it may take 6 weeks to get your money back. :headache:

***Update***

Due to wdrl's post I decided to investigate further. Now the night front desk crew and the suit on duty at BWV tells me that our account was CC charged because they accidently got our account mixed up with someone with the same last name.

They state that the deluxe room limit is now $2000 and that they will charge to your CC on file if you are closer than 20% of the new limit or if you charge tickets. They said that day crew needs additional training and that other guests have asked the same question but they didn't know where the wrong info was originating from. The suit says that she will talk to the CM who I originally talked to.

I recommend that everyone ask when checking in what the CC charge policy is and don't expect the same answer from all CM's.

We just stayed at PVB for four nights and AKV-Kidani for 12 nights. At no time was our charge card billed as frequently as may have happened in your case. For our stay at PVB, our credit card was not billed until we checked out on the fifth day. Our AKV stay was technically two linked stays of eight and four nights. Our credit card was billed when the first eight-night stay was completed, and then it was billed again when the four-night stay was completed. We definitely did not get billed every 2-3 days.

When I checked in at AKV, I specifically asked the front desk CM how they would handle our linked stays. I was primarily concerned about being able to stay in the same villa for the entire 12 nights, but I also asked other things, including how the billing would be handled. The CM said that we would billed at the end of the first 8-night stay, then again at the end of the second 4-night stay, or whenever our outstanding balance approached $1,500. She made no mention of us being billed as frequently as every two or three days.
